The MAXSUN RTX 4080 Turbo T0 dramatically outperforms the NVIDIA RTX PRO 4000 Blackwell SFF, leading by 53% in the overall GPI performance index. For machine learning, the MAXSUN RTX 4080 Turbo T0 has the edge in FP16 performance (+90%). For gaming, the MAXSUN RTX 4080 Turbo T0 delivers 90% more FP32 throughput. In performance per watt, the NVIDIA RTX PRO 4000 Blackwell SFF is 141% more efficient at 70W TDP vs 320W for the MAXSUN RTX 4080 Turbo T0.
